Exterior Drain Cleaning in Denver, CO
Exterior drain cleaning services focus on removing debris, sludge, and blockages from outdoor drainage systems to ensure proper water flow and prevent flooding or water damage. This service typically covers projects such as clearing clogged gutters, downspouts, yard drains, and stormwater management systems. Homeowners often request exterior drain cleaning to address issues like overflowing gutters, pooling water around the foundation, or drainage problems after heavy rainfall, aiming to maintain the integrity of their property and avoid costly repairs.

Common Exterior Drain Cleaning Jobs
Gutter and downspout cleaning - clearing debris to prevent blockages and water damage.
Storm drain maintenance - removing leaves and dirt to ensure proper drainage during heavy rains.
Exterior drain line flushing - using high-pressure water to clear stubborn clogs and buildup.
Eavestrough cleaning - preventing overflow and water intrusion around the roofline.
Drainage system inspection - identifying potential issues before they cause costly damage.
Outdoor drain repair - fixing damaged or broken drains to maintain proper water flow.
Exterior Drain Cleaning Questions
What is exterior drain cleaning? Exterior drain cleaning involves removing debris, dirt, and obstructions from outdoor drainage systems to ensure proper water flow away from the property.
Why is regular drain cleaning important? Regular cleaning helps prevent clogs, flooding, and water damage by keeping outdoor drains clear and functioning properly.
What types of drains are typically cleaned? Commonly cleaned drains include yard drains, gutter downspouts, stormwater drains, and driveway catch basins.
How can I tell if my exterior drains need cleaning? Signs include standing water near drains, slow drainage, or debris buildup visible in grates or openings.
